Network Rail favours flexible approach

Recruiters have been urged to take a flexible approach to recruitment by Adrian Thomas, head of resourcing at Network Rail.

Thomas told Recruiter: “For the vast majority of our vacancies we try to reach out to the candidate directly. When we do use agencies we want them to be flexible on their service offering. Often we just want to map other companies or to have an initial introduction – our in-house recruitment team then take over. It’s more than just margins. Agencies need to evaluate if they have got their service offering right.”
